In this session, we will discuss the Vector API in a preview in Java. We will begin by introducing SIMD (single instruction, multiple data) and explore how it can be used to maximize computation speed. The session will then cover the setup required to use the Vector API, including how to establish a species, define and use components and lanes, and apply masking with different strategies. We will also discuss same-lane and cross-lane computation. Finally, we will conclude by presenting metrics comparing the performance of using the Vector API versus not using it.
This session is primarily aimed at backend developers working on performance-intensive applications, as they can leverage the Vector API to optimize computational tasks. Software architects are the secondary audience, as they need to understand the implications of using the Vector API when designing high-performance systems that require efficient data processing. DeepTech professionals may also find this session valuable on account of its focus on advanced computational techniques and performance optimizations using SIMD and the Vector API.
Speaker: Daniel Hinojosa
Daniel Hinojosa has been a self-employed developer, teacher, and speaker for private business, education, and government since 1999. A Java Champion, he is passionate about languages, frameworks, and programming education. Daniel is a Pomodoro Technique practitioner and is the co-founder of the Albuquerque Java User Group in Albuquerque, New Mexico.
